Volunteers with Passaic Valley Hospice visit our terminally ill patients in their homes throughout northern New Jersey. Our goal is to support patients physically, emotionally and spiritually, and their families, so those in their final months can live as fully and comfortably as possible and finish their journey with dignity and peace.

Volunteers provide companionship for patients and families, and help with respite for caregivers. There are also needs for assistance with office work and making bereavement phone calls. Training is provided with continuing coaching available.

Mission Statement

To provide quality end of life care to terminally ill patients. Hospice is a comprehensive program of care which allows the terminally ill to live comfortably and with dignity at home until time of death.

Description

Passaic Valley Hospice offers the patient and the family/caregivers support with a coordinated team of nurses, home health aides, social workers, clergy & volunteers. Our volunteers mostly spend time with patients in their homes once a week for 2 hours, as needed.
